The Sudden Cancellation That Shocked Fans

Why CBS Cancelled NCIS: Hawai‘i After Season 3

Despite solid ratings, CBS canceled the show in 2024. Why?

  • Rising production costs

  • Network budget restructuring

  • A crowded NCIS universe

  • Strategic shifts toward cheaper productions

In short, it wasn’t about quality—it was about money.
